You would think that the things in config.site that begin
with the # sign are actually the ones used by default.
They're not, at least in my experience. Unfortunately, this
is documented NOWHERE.
In your testing of this, did you actually determine that ZIP was enabled in the default build? Because mine by the default build won't do AdobeDeflate compression (which is a variant on Deflate, enabled by the same option), and by changing only that one configuration item and rebuilding the package, it fixed my ability to use AdobeFlate. In short, are you sure? Because I'm pretty sure that you've got to get rid of that blasted # to get ZIP/Deflate/AdobeFlate to work. - P sed -i 's/#ZIP/ZIP/' config.site |
